Who doesn’t love a sweet treat now and then? Whether it’s a decadent dessert or a simple piece of chocolate, indulging in something sweet can bring joy and satisfaction. However, there’s an art to enjoying sweets mindfully and healthily. In this blog post, we’ll explore how to eat sweet in a way that enhances your culinary experience and supports your well-being.
1. **Choose Quality Over Quantity:**
When it comes to sweets, quality matters. Opt for treats made with high-quality ingredients, whether you’re buying them or making them at home. This not only enhances the flavor but also ensures that you’re getting the best nutritional value from your indulgence.
2. **Mindful Portions:**
Practice portion control when enjoying sweets. Instead of devouring an entire cake or a bag of candies in one sitting, savor a small portion and truly appreciate the flavors and textures. Eating mindfully allows you to enjoy the experience without overindulging.
3. **Balance Your Diet:**
Incorporate sweets into a balanced diet rather than considering them as occasional indulgences. By balancing your meals with nutritious foods like fruits, vegetables, lean proteins, and whole grains, you can enjoy sweets without feeling guilty.
4. **Explore Different Flavors:**
Don’t limit yourself to just one type of sweet. Explore a variety of flavors and textures, from rich chocolates to fruity sorbets, creamy desserts, and crunchy cookies. This variety keeps your taste buds excited and prevents monotony.
5. **Homemade Goodness:**
Consider making your own sweets at home. Not only does this give you control over the ingredients and sweetness levels, but it can also be a fun and rewarding activity. Plus, homemade treats often taste better than store-bought ones!
6. **Savor the Moment:**
When you indulge in something sweet, take the time to savor each bite. Pay attention to the flavors, aromas, and sensations in your mouth. This mindful approach enhances your enjoyment and helps you feel more satisfied with smaller portions.
7. **Pairing and Combinations:**
Explore the art of pairing sweets with complementary flavors. For example, a piece of dark chocolate goes wonderfully with a cup of coffee or red wine. Discovering these pairings can elevate your sweet-eating experience.
8. **Be Conscious of Sugar Content:**
While enjoying sweets is delightful, it’s essential to be mindful of sugar content. Opt for sweets with natural sweeteners or lower sugar alternatives when possible. This way, you can indulge without worrying too much about excessive sugar intake.
9. **Share the Joy:**
Sweet treats are meant to be shared. Enjoy desserts and sweets with family and friends, creating memorable moments together. Sharing not only spreads happiness but also encourages moderation.
10. **Listen to Your Body:**
Lastly, listen to your body’s cues. If you’re satisfied after a few bites, there’s no need to continue eating. Understanding your hunger and fullness signals helps you enjoy sweets without overdoing it.
In conclusion, eating sweets can be a delightful and fulfilling experience when approached mindfully. By choosing quality treats, practicing portion control, balancing your diet, and savoring each moment, you can indulge in sweets while supporting your well-being.
